Search Unity

Question Unable to reference NavMeshSurface.

Discussion in 'Navigation' started by AcidmanRPGz, Feb 13, 2024.

  1. AcidmanRPGz


    Feb 14, 2020
    Upon updating from Unity 2020 to 2022, my script responsible for baking the navmesh in runtime (which is a necessary action as it allows me to create procedural arenas and levels) doesn't work. The component reference is still there for NavMeshSurface, but when I drag the component in, it won't actually fill it in.

    There don't appear to be any NavMeshSurface components in the game according to the menus, despite the component existing and being in the scene.


    Can someone either tell me what is wrong, or tell me how to use the new architecture to do the same thing? I just need to be able to Build my navmesh in runtime.